About the role
The position involves engaging in unit councils, professional governance, and quality initiatives to enhance care processes and apply evidence-based practices. The RN utilizes the nursing process to assess, plan, diagnose, implement, and evaluate nursing care, ensuring effective communication and collaboration with patients and families.
Responsibilities
- Maintains accurate, timely EHR documentation.
- May administer medications, treatments, and therapies safely and according to clinical protocols and procedures.
- Engages in professional development, completes required education, and maintains certifications.
- Communicates effectively, provides feedback, resolves conflicts, and delegates tasks appropriately.
- Maintains a safe environment, evaluates patient, team, and unit outcomes, and takes corrective actions as necessary.
- Works in a fast-paced, dynamic environment, managing multiple priorities.
- Performs physical safety interventions such as patient restraint and verbal de-escalation.
- May be required to float to other units, departments, care areas, or facilities within the designated service area.
Requirements
- Graduate of a Board of Nursing approved nursing education program.
- Basic Life Support (BLS) certification.
- Active registered nurse (RN) multi-state compact and/or single-state license with privileges to practice in the state(s) where the RN is providing client nursing services.
- Knowledge of the principles of growth and development over the life span and ability to assess data reflective of the patient's status.
- Ability to communicate effectively, work in a fast-paced environment, and manage multiple priorities.
Qualifications
- Bachelor of Science degree in Nursing (BSN).
- Experience typically requires 1 year of clinical nursing experience.
